Navigating the Legalities: Company and Non-Profit Organization Registration in Pakistan

Embarking on a business journey in Pakistan necessitates securing legal status through formalization. Whether you're establishing a firm or an civil society organization, understanding the registration process is crucial. This involves complying with specific legal requirements set by the relevant authorities.

  • Businesses in Pakistan can be registered under various acts, including the Companies Act, 2017. The process typically involves filing applications with the Securities and Exchange Commission of Pakistan (SECP) and providing necessary documents such as a memorandum and articles of association, shareholder information, and proof of address.
  • Civil Society Groups in Pakistan can register under the Societies Registration Act, 1860. This process requires submitting an application to the relevant provincial government department, including a constitution outlining the organization's mission, activities, and management structure.

Properly registering your company or NGO affirms legal status, enabling you to operate officially. It also opens doors to accessing support from both local and international organizations.
